Massive Crowd Assembles⁢ in Downtown Los Angeles for⁤ ‘anti-Oligarchy’ Event Featuring Sanders and Ocasio-Cortez

An immense multitude,⁣ estimated to be in⁤ the tens of thousands,‍ converged upon Gloria Molina Grand Park, situated ⁢in the heart of ​Los Angeles, earlier⁣ today. ​The energized throng ‍gathered to listen ‍to prominent progressive voices, Senator Bernie Sanders and Representative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, as they⁤ headlined a rally centered ⁤on combating the influence of oligarchy in American ​society.

The‍ event, dubbed the ‘Fighting Oligarchy’ rally, drew individuals from across the Southern California ​region and ⁣beyond, demonstrating the important ⁢public concern surrounding issues of economic inequality and‌ the concentration of⁣ power. Attendees, spanning diverse age groups and backgrounds, ‌filled the expansive park, creating a vibrant atmosphere of civic engagement⁤ and shared purpose.

Senator Sanders, known for his long-standing advocacy for working ​families and his critiques of wealth disparity, delivered a passionate address that resonated deeply with the assembled‌ crowd. He articulated his vision for a more equitable society, emphasizing the⁤ need ​to challenge the dominance of powerful corporate interests and ensure a level playing field for all Americans. His speech‌ underscored key​ themes from his political platform, including‍ Medicare for All, free collage tuition, and raising the ​minimum wage, framing ‍these policies⁣ as essential steps to dismantle oligarchic structures.

Representative Ocasio-Cortez, a rising figure in progressive politics, followed Senator Sanders with an equally compelling and dynamic presentation. She ‌connected the concept of ‍oligarchy to contemporary‍ issues ⁤such as climate change, housing affordability, and⁣ access to healthcare,​ arguing that⁣ these challenges are exacerbated by the undue influence of wealthy elites and special interests. ‌ Ocasio-Cortez emphasized the importance of grassroots movements and collective action⁢ in reclaiming democratic power and building a more just and enduring future. She‍ drew parallels to historical​ movements for social change, inspiring attendees to become active participants in shaping policy and holding elected⁢ officials accountable.

The choice‌ of Gloria molina Grand Park as the venue underscored ⁤the event’s accessibility and symbolic meaning. Located amidst the towering skyscrapers of downtown Los Angeles, the park served‍ as ‍a ​powerful visual contrast – a public ⁤space reclaimed for grassroots activism in⁤ the shadow of corporate power. ​ The sheer ​size of the turnout served as a potent reminder ‍of the enduring appeal of ‌progressive ideals and the growing movement advocating for systemic⁣ change in the face of perceived oligarchic control. Organizers highlighted ‌the event as a crucial ⁣step in building momentum for policies ⁢aimed at reducing economic inequality and strengthening democratic institutions.

this ‘Fighting Oligarchy’ ⁢rally in los Angeles mirrors similar gatherings and‌ movements gaining traction across the nation, reflecting a broader societal conversation about the⁢ distribution ⁣of wealth​ and⁢ power. As concerns about economic fairness and political depiction intensify, ⁤events like this ‍underscore the enduring relevance of figures like Sanders and Ocasio-Cortez in articulating‌ and⁢ mobilizing public‌ sentiment for a⁣ more ⁤equitable and democratic society.⁢ The energy and enthusiasm displayed by ​the thousands in attendance suggest that the dialog surrounding ‍oligarchy and its ​impact⁣ on American life will‍ continue to be a central theme in the ongoing political discourse.
